Strategic Resource Management
In NukeWorld, resources are scarce and must be managed meticulously. Players are tasked with gathering essential supplies such as food, water, and fuel, which are integral to sustaining life in this harsh environment. Innovative gameplay mechanics challenge players to optimize supply use and develop sustainable sources to ensure long-term survival.
Alliance and Diplomacy
The game introduces a robust diplomacy system allowing players to form alliances or engage in tactical conflicts with other survivors. This dynamic interaction reflects real-world diplomatic efforts, encouraging players to weigh the benefits of collaboration against the potential risks posed by rival factions.
Environmental Dynamics
NukeWorld's environment reacts to players' choices, showcasing the potential impact of human activities on the natural world. In-game weather patterns, radiation levels, and ecosystem changes are influenced by player decisions, simulating the real-world consequences of environmental practices and adding layers of depth to strategic planning.

The Role of the JL768
In NukeWorld, the enigmatic element known as JL768 plays a pivotal role. This fictional isotope is central to the game’s lore and serves as a coveted resource with powerful capabilities. Players must decide whether to harness JL768’s capabilities for technological advancements or risk its volatile potential in weaponry against others, further illustrating moral complexities and the theme of power asymmetry.
